Billings Sr High School is a large high school in Billings, Montana, enrolling 1,629 students.
Class loads run heavy: 16.3:1 is larger than about 88% of Montana schools and 38% above the 11.8:1 state mean, so each teacher carries more students than is typical.
By headcount it is one of the larger campuses in Montana, bigger than 99% of state schools at 1,629 students.
Its Resource Investment Index lands in the lower third of 826 scored Montana schools.
Its student body is led by White (69%) and Hispanic or Latino (11%), more mixed than most schools in the state (diversity index 49/100).
On the academic-pipeline side it reports 17 Advanced Placement courses.
Counselor coverage runs a bit thin, about 272 students per counselor, somewhat past the ASCA-recommended 250:1 benchmark.
Chronic absenteeism is elevated: 57.7% of students missed 10% or more of school days (2021-22 Civil Rights Data Collection).
The surrounding Billings H S spends $11,891 per pupil, 38% below the Montana average, a leaner-resourced district than most.
Among Billings's high schools, it stands alongside Billings West High School (2,115 students): Billings Sr High School is smaller than that campus by headcount and runs heavier classes (16.3:1 vs 15.3:1).
Billings H S also operates Billings West High School (2,115 students) and Skyview High School (1,542 students) alongside Billings Sr High School.
